Feelings
Presentation by Laraine. Handouts: list of classes of emotions, anger iceberg, brain structures
Feelings are not just in the head, they are felt in the body. If you don't acknowledge you are feeling something, it doesn't go away, it goes underground and appears in other forms. Your ability to hear what is actually said deteriorates when you are upset. Anger is an expression of a lot of feelings. It helps manage a feeling if you can identify it and acknowledge it.
Pre-Proposal Discussion about Tree Decisions
Proposed: All tree-related decisions will be made by the landscaping committee rather than the community as a whole, including planting, trimming, and removal. Removal will only be by recommendation of qualified arborist. Plans will be communicated to the community before being acted on. Draft by Ben.
Community opinions range from advocating removing all the Siberian elms to keeping all trees if at all possible and holding prayer services for any tree being removed.
Concern that Landscaping committee should represent at least a minimum number of households; maybe provision to discontinue policy if Landscaping committee becomes only a couple of people.
Keep people empowered to do landscape projects.
Create documents that help people, like recommendations on tree species, proper planting techniques, distance from structures.
